Local disks

The local disk is connected directly to the compute server through the PCIe interface via NVMe protocol. Therefore, a local disk can only be created with cloud database cluster.

The local disk has no network latency, so it is suitable for tasks that are sensitive to read and write speeds.

Performance and throughput

Local disk performance and throughput in fixed Standard Line and HighFreq Line configurations depends on the disk size.

Drives
256 GB
Drives
512 GB
Drives
768 GB
Drives
1 TB
Drives
1,5 TB
Throughput400 MB/s500 MB/s600 MB/s700 MB/s800 MB/s
Performance (read)25,600 IOPS40,000 IOPS50,000 IOPS60,000 IOPS70,000 IOPS
Performance (write)12,800 IOPS20,000 IOPS25,000 IOPS30,000 IOPS35,000 IOPS

Local Disk Features

  • SSD NVMe disk.
  • The disk subsystem is configured in RAID 10.
  • A cloud database can only have one local disk.
  • You cannot disconnect from a cloud database and connect to another database.
  • You can't maximize directly, you can only change node configuration.
  • Deleted with all data when the node is deleted.
